A brilliant new browser-based experiment is making the notoriously complex geometry of neural networks accessible and visually stunning for everyone. By allowing users to dynamically map how different optimizers navigate these high-dimensional spaces, this tool bridges the gap between abstract math and clear intuition. It is an incredibly exciting resource for both researchers and enthusiasts looking to explore the fascinating topologies of models like ResNet-8.
Key Takeaways
- •The tool uses a recognized NeurIPS 2018 methodology to generate accurate 3D surface plots of high-dimensional loss landscapes.
- •Users can seamlessly experiment with various architectures like LeNet-5 and ResNet-8, switching between synthetic and real image datasets entirely client-side.
- •This visualization provides a powerful new way to intuitively understand complex optimization theory and model behavior without needing supercomputing resources.
